  • Step 2: Implement Automated Testing

Automated testing plays a crucial role in establishing an Efficient QA Review process. By utilizing automated testing tools, teams can significantly reduce the time spent on routine testing and enhance accuracy simultaneously. Unlike manual testing, which can be labor-intensive and prone to human error, automation allows for quicker execution of test cases and instant feedback on software quality.

To implement automated testing effectively, consider the following steps:

  1. Identify Test Cases: Begin by determining which tests are repetitive and can be automated. Focus on regression tests, which validate that new changes don't disrupt existing functionality.

  2. Select Appropriate Tools: Choose automation tools that align with your project needs. Tools like Selenium offer robust frameworks for web application testing, streamlining the process.

  3. Create a Maintenance Plan: Regularly review and update your automated tests to reflect changes in the software. A well-maintained test suite ensures continued relevance and reliability.

By integrating these elements, you can achieve a streamlined review process without sacrificing the integrity of QA standards.

  • Tool 1: Selenium

Selenium stands out as a powerful tool for achieving efficient QA review by automating web application testing. This open-source framework allows teams to create automated tests for web applications across different browsers. By using Selenium, teams can save substantial time in the review process without sacrificing accuracy. This efficiency is crucial for maintaining high standards in QA while meeting tight deadlines.

One of the key features of Selenium is its capability to simulate real user interactions with web applications. This can include everything from clicking buttons to entering text in forms. By automating these tasks, Selenium enables QA teams to focus on analyzing results rather than performing repetitive actions manually. Furthermore, the framework supports various programming languages, making it adaptable to different technical environments.

Incorporating Selenium into your QA process not only accelerates testing cycles but also bolsters the accuracy of your evaluations. As a result, organizations can deliver quality products more swiftly, maintaining essential reliability in user experiences. By adopting such automated solutions, the pursuit of efficient QA review becomes an attainable goal.

  • Tool 3: JIRA

JIRA is a powerful project management tool that can significantly enhance your QA review process. By integrating JIRA into your workflow, teams can efficiently track bugs, manage tasks, and streamline communication across departments. This centralization helps maintain clarity and ensures every team member is aware of their responsibilities, ultimately leading to a more efficient QA review process without sacrificing accuracy.

Using JIRA’s customizable workflows, teams can establish precise steps for tracking tasks and addressing issues. The tool enables real-time updates and feedback, which fosters collaboration between developers and quality assurance teams. As issues are reported and prioritized within JIRA, your team can respond swiftly, thereby reducing review time and ensuring that quality standards remain high. Overall, leveraging JIRA not only boosts efficiency but also nurtures a culture of accountability and transparency in QA practices.
